A time period is setup by the two timers TIME PERIOD A
and TIME PERIOD B, and the following procedure can be
used to specify four different periods per day based on
time period settings (for instance, early morning, morning,
lunchtime, and night). For example, it is possible to set
TIME PERIOD A for automatic screen selection and the
period between TIME PERIOD B for the masking of
monitor video using a gray pattern.
Morning to lunchtime: 6:00 to 11:00
Cameras No. 2, 4, 5, 7, 10 and 16 are masked.
Lunchtime: 11:00 to 13:00
Cameras No. 1, 4, 6, 11, 12, 13 and 14 are masked.
Lunchtime to night: 13:00 to 20:00
Cameras No. 1, 5, 9, 12 automatic selection is carried out.
Night to morning: 20:00 to 6:00
Cameras No. 1, 8 and 16 automatic selection is carried
out.
The following are functions with operations based on time
periods.
When using time periods, be sure to set for each interval
with the following menu.
Setting automatic selection of camera video
Set which automatically selected camera to display video
from and the switching interval.
To do this, set “2.SEQUENCE SET” from <SCREEN
SET>. (JP.102)
Masking camera video using a gray pattern
Use “3.MASK SET” from <SCREEN SET> to specify which
cameras are to be displayed on the monitor and which are
not. (JP.104)
Alarm recording using motion sensors
Alarm recording is activated by motion sensor.
To detect camera alarms, set “MOTION SENSOR” from
<ALARM REC MODE SET>. (JP.81)
